Why These Are the Top Kitchen Remodeling Contractors in Blythe

** The kitchen remodeling market for Blythe, Georgia, and the wider CSRA is moderately competitive and service-driven. As a smaller city, Blythe itself has very few, if any, dedicated kitchen remodelers, necessitating reliance on contractors based in the Augusta metropolitan area. The quality of providers is generally high, with several well-established franchises and reputable local contractors dominating the market. Homeowners can expect a range of options from specialized cabinet and cosmetic updates (from franchises like Kitchen Solvers and Kitchen Tune-Up) to comprehensive full-service renovations (from established local contractors like Augusta Handyman). Typical pricing for a full kitchen remodel in this region can range from **$15,000 - $45,000+**, heavily dependent on the materials (e.g., granite vs. quartz countertops), the scale of layout changes, and the level of custom cabinetry. The market is characterized by contractors who are accustomed to serving a mix of suburban and rural clients, often requiring a willingness to travel to locations like Blythe. It is always recommended to verify a contractor's license and insurance directly and to obtain multiple detailed quotes before proceeding.

1What is a realistic budget range for a full kitchen remodel in Blythe, GA, and what factors influence the cost locally?

For a full remodel in Blythe, budgets typically range from $25,000 to $50,000+, depending on the scope and material choices. Local factors influencing cost include the need to update older home systems common in the area, material transportation fees if sourcing from Augusta or Atlanta, and the local labor market. Georgia's sales tax on materials and labor also applies to the final cost.

2How does the climate in Blythe, Georgia, affect my choices for kitchen materials and design?

Blythe's humid subtropical climate means you should prioritize materials resistant to moisture and humidity fluctuations to prevent warping or mold. Opt for moisture-resistant cabinetry (like plywood boxes), quartz or solid-surface countertops, and proper ventilation hoods to manage heat and humidity from cooking. Ensuring good insulation and sealing around windows is also key for energy efficiency during hot Georgia summers.

3Do I need a permit for a kitchen remodel in Blythe, and what local regulations should I know about?

Yes, permits are often required for structural changes, electrical, and plumbing work in Richmond County. Your contractor should handle this, but it's crucial to verify they are licensed and insured under Georgia state law. Local codes will dictate requirements for GFCI outlets near water sources, ventilation, and potentially water-saving fixtures, so working with a provider familiar with Blythe and county inspections is essential.

4What's the best time of year to undertake a kitchen remodel in this region, and how long will it typically take?

The ideal time is during Georgia's milder fall or spring to avoid the peak summer heat and humidity, which can affect material delivery and worker comfort. A full remodel typically takes 6 to 12 weeks from planning to completion. Scheduling can be impacted by local events and contractor availability, so planning several months in advance is recommended to secure your preferred start date.

5How can I find and vet a reliable local kitchen remodeling contractor in the Blythe area?

Start by seeking referrals from neighbors or local hardware stores, and look for contractors with strong, verifiable references in the CSRA (Central Savannah River Area). Always verify their Georgia state license through the Secretary of State's website, confirm they carry general liability and workers' compensation insurance, and ensure they provide detailed, written contracts. A reputable local contractor will understand area-specific issues like older home foundations and local supply chains.
